Technical Field

The invention relates to a scouring agent used in the technical field of textile printing and dyeing and a preparation method thereof, and more particularly relates to a high-performance environment-friendly scouring agent and a preparation method thereof.

Background

The scouring process is a complex chemical and physical chemical process of textiles at a certain temperature with alkali and scouring aids, and comprises the actions of penetration, emulsification, solubilization, dispersion, chelation and the like. An excellent scouring agent is required to have not only a good ability to reduce the surface tension of a solution and a good speed of penetrating into the inside of fibers, but also a saponification, emulsification, dispersion, etc. of natural impurities on the fibers.

The anionic surfactant has good alkali resistance and washing property, and the nonionic surfactant has good wettability and emulsibility, so that the scouring agent for the textile is mainly a surfactant mixture compounded by anions and non-ions at present. Although the anionic surfactant can improve the alkali resistance of the whole scouring agent, the anionic surfactant has extremely high foam, bubbles can overflow in the application process, the concentration of the working solution is low, the expected effect cannot be achieved, and if the anionic surfactant is not uniformly treated, dyeing defects can also appear in the subsequent dyeing process, so that great loss is caused to a printing and dyeing plant. At present, two common solutions are provided, namely, a silicone defoaming agent is added and used in patents CN109797551A and CN108660752A, but the compatibility of the existing defoaming agent to a scouring agent is extremely poor, floating oil appears after the defoaming agent is added, and the stability of the scouring agent is reduced; secondly, a phosphate ester surfactant with high alkali resistance and low foaming is added, such as alcohol ether phosphate added in patent CN109338720A, the eutrophication of the water body is easily caused by the high phosphorus content, and some companies have clearly shown that the phosphate ester surfactant is forbidden. In addition, due to the compatibility between surfactants and the difference of the solubility of the surfactants in water, a small molecular solvent is required to be added for solubilization in order to prepare a stable scouring agent, and potential safety hazards are generated due to volatilization and pungent odor of the solvent. The scouring agents described in patents CN109056319B, CN108978188B and CN108660752A have a certain amount of solvents such as butyl diglycol and isopropyl alcohol.

Therefore, aiming at the problems, the solvent-free high-performance scouring agent which has the properties of low foam, high alkali resistance, high permeability, high detergency, environmental protection and stability, meets the requirements of large alkali consumption, quick permeability, low foam and good detergency in the pretreatment process of textiles, can be applied to various processing modes such as continuous and discontinuous textiles and has important practical value is developed.

Disclosure of Invention

The invention aims to provide a high-performance environment-friendly scouring agent composition and a preparation method thereof

One aspect of the invention provides a high-performance environment-friendly scouring agent composition, which comprises the following components:

another aspect of the invention provides a method for preparing a high performance, environmentally friendly scouring agent composition, which comprises

The method comprises the following steps:

(1) adding 30-80% of water, a carboxylate Gemini chelating dispersant and a hyperbranched block polyether surfactant into a reaction kettle, and stirring at 40-60 ℃ until the solid is dissolved;

(2) sequentially adding C12-C18 long-chain carboxylic ester polyoxyethylene sulfonate, full-branched-chain fatty alcohol-polyoxyethylene ether, plant polyene phenol polyoxyethylene ether and the balance of water into the mixture formed in the step (1), and continuously stirring for 20-90 min at 50-60 ℃ until the mixture is uniformly mixed;

(3) cooling to room temperature to obtain the high-performance environment-friendly scouring agent composition.

Compared with the existing scouring agent and the preparation method thereof, the raw materials used by the method are all high-permeability and low-foam surfactants, the emulsifying property is high, and the prepared scouring agent is suitable for continuous and discontinuous various processing modes; the raw materials have high compatibility and excellent cooperativity, APEO and phosphorus are not contained, and the prepared scouring agent has high stability, high efficiency and environmental protection;

the high-performance environment-friendly scouring agent composition prepared by the invention has excellent performances of low foam, high permeability, high emulsification, high alkali resistance and the like, is suitable for two continuous and discontinuous pretreatment processes of textiles, and has excellent comprehensive performance of the textiles after treatment; the raw materials used for preparing the scouring agent do not contain substances such as phosphorus, APEO, organic solvents and the like, and the sustainable development concept is met.

In a more preferred embodiment, the hyperbranched block polyether used has a weight average molecular weight of 18000 to 80000, preferably 30000 to 60000, EO: PO is 5:1 to 2:1, preferably 4:1 to 3: 1.

In a more preferred embodiment, the water used is generally water commonly used in the industry, preferably deionized water.

In a more preferred embodiment, a method for preparing a high performance eco-friendly scouring agent composition of the present invention comprises the steps of:

(1) adding 30-80 wt% of water, 0.5-3 wt% of carboxylate Gemini chelating dispersant and 3-10 wt% of hyperbranched block polyether surfactant into a reaction kettle, and stirring at 40-60 ℃ until the solid is dissolved;

(2) sequentially adding 5-18 wt% of C12-C18 long-chain carboxylic ester polyoxyethylene sulfonate, 10-20 wt% of full-branched-chain fatty alcohol-polyoxyethylene ether, 6-10 wt% of plant polyene phenol polyoxyethylene ether and the balance of water into the mixture formed in the step (1), and continuously stirring for 20-60 min at 50-60 ℃ until the mixture is uniformly mixed;

(3) cooling to room temperature to obtain the high-performance environment-friendly scouring agent composition.

In a more preferred embodiment, the stirring used in the above-described process steps (1) and (2) is carried out at 200 and 400 rpm.

The scouring agent prepared by the invention is easy to degrade, has good environmental protection property, low foam, high alkali resistance and high permeability, can obtain excellent whiteness and capillary effect when being applied to the pretreatment of textiles, and can improve the production efficiency and reduce the production defects.
